Skip to content

Commit 1a3715c

Browse files
authored
Update Dockerfile
1 parent 47ca527 commit 1a3715c

File tree

1 file changed

+4
-4
lines changed

1 file changed

+4
-4
lines changed

Dockerfile

Lines changed: 4 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-3,20 +3,20 @@ FROM rust:latest AS backend-builder
33
WORKDIR /app
44

55
# 复制 Rust 依赖文件,以便利用缓存
6-
COPY Cargo.toml Cargo.lock ./
6+
# COPY Cargo.toml Cargo.lock ./
77

88
# 创建 src 目录,防止 cargo build 失败
9-
RUN mkdir src && echo "fn main() {}" > src/main.rs
9+
# RUN mkdir src && echo "fn main() {}" > src/main.rs
1010

1111
# 预先构建依赖,缓存编译结果
12-
RUN cargo build --release --verbose || true
12+
# RUN cargo build --release --verbose || true
1313

1414
# 复制前端编译产物到后端的 dist 目录
1515
COPY dist /app/dist
1616

1717
# 复制后端代码并编译
1818
COPY ./ ./
19-
RUN cargo build --release --verbose
19+
RUN cargo build --release
2020

2121
# 第二阶段:构建最终运行环境
2222
FROM ubuntu:latest

0 commit comments

Comments
 (0)